The passages youโ€™ve prayed from 1 Timothy remind us that the ultimate purpose of lifting up kings and all who are in high positions is not merely that our own lives might be quiet and undisturbed. It is that the way might be open for the gospel to spread, for all people to be saved and come to the knowledge of the truth. That is the deep, merciful longing of Godโ€™s heart. So when we pray for a president, a senator, a judge, or a pastor, we are not just asking for wise decisions; we are asking that their hearts would be turned to the true King, that the chains of worldly thinking would fall away, and that they would become, whether they know it or not, instruments in the hand of God for the preservation of good.

Governments exist, in Godโ€™s design, to restrain evil and to reward what is right. When a nationโ€™s laws begin to protect what is evil and silence what is good, that nation stands on perilous ground. The wisdom of this world, which is earthly, sensual, and devilish, always leads to confusion and every vile deed. But the wisdom from above is first pure, then peaceable, gentle, open to reason. So when you pray, ask specifically that this heaven-sent wisdom would settle upon our leaders. Ask that the fear of the Lord, which is the beginning of wisdom, would grip their souls, even the worst of them. For God is able to save the worst, and nothing is too hard for Him.

Do not grow weary in this work. The apostle Paul, chained in a Roman prison, understood that prayer was not bound by walls or guards. From his cell, he was laboring fervently for churches across the known world. Your prayers, too, are not limited by geography or circumstance. They rise before the throne and move the hand that governs the universe. Our prayers do not change Godโ€™s mind as though He were reluctant; they are the means by which He has chosen to accomplish His will, the means by which He draws us into communion with Him and lets us share in His purposes. So persist with thanksgiving, watching to see how the Lord works.

Remember that the heart of prayer is not to get our own agenda enacted, but to see His kingdom come and His will done on earth as it is in heaven. That is your guide and your rest. You are not responsible for the outcome, but you are called to be faithful in the asking. Christ Jesus is ever living to make intercession for us, and your prayers simply join the stream of His own eternal prayer. So let the peace of God guard your heart and mind as you commit all these leaders, the one you respect and the one you struggle to honor, into His omnipotent care. He is on the throne. The Lord God omnipotent reigns.
